cmmi认证的基础知识,有什么好处
日期:3/17/2023 3:13:20 PM 点击:290
CMMI认证的基础知识 信息技术(IT)的发展迅猛,带动了组织的转型。组织的竞争对手不再仅仅是传统的市场对手,还包括来自全球的竞争对手。因此,组织必须寻求一种独特的方式来改进业务流程,以保持竞争优势。业界已经认识到了这一点,并开始利用软件工程规范来提高业务流程的有效性和效率。
软件工程规范提供了一种评估和改进业务流程的方法。它们为组织提供了一个公开透明的方法来评估业务流程,并且可以帮助组织改进业务流程。软件工程规范有助于组织确定哪些业务流程需要改进,并提供了适当的指导方针和指标来帮助组织进行改进。
软件工程规范通常被分为两类:项目管理规范和开发规范。项目管理规范提供了关于如何管理软件项目的指导方针。开发规范提供了关于如何开发软件的指导方针。项目管理规范和开发规范的结合称为软件工程框架。
软件工程规范的发展历程 一般来说,软件工程规范的发展可以分为三个阶段:基础阶段、发展阶段和成熟阶段。
基础阶段:软件工程规范的发展始于上个世纪70年代。当时,软件开发的规模较小,主要集中在军事和政府领域。这些领域的需求要求开发大型和复杂的软件系统,而这些系统又要求高质量和可靠性。鉴于这些需求,需要开发一种新的软件开发方法。这就是软件工程学诞生的原因。
软件工程学是应用工程知识来开发软件的一门学科。软件工程学结合了计算机科学、管理学和工程学的知识,旨在通过科学方法来开发、测试和维护软件。软件工程学的发展推动了软件工程规范的发展。
软件工程规范的发展主要集中在两个方面:项目管理方面和开发方面。项目管理方面的规范主要集中在项目计划、项目监控和项目控制等方面。开发方面的规范主要集中在开发过程、代码质量和系统集成等方面。
发展阶段:在软件工程规范的发展史上,发展阶段是从上个世纪80年代开始的。当时,随着软件开发技术的进步,软件工程规范也发生了很大的变化。在这个阶段,规范的主要目的是提高软件开发的质量和可靠性。
为了实现这一目标,软件工程规范逐渐形成了一个体系,这个体系包括了项目管理规范和开发规范。项目管理规范和开发规范相互支持,形成了一个完整的软件工程框架。软件工程框架的形成,促进了软件开发的质量和可靠性的提高。
在软件工程规范的发展过程